Liverpool FC has renewed its cooperation partnership with Kunming Education Bureau during the inaugural China International Import Expo in Shanghai and looks to develop a longer partnership to help with the region’s football training.
Earlier this year in April, the Premier League football club reached a 6-month youth football training collaboration with the Kunming Education Bureau. LFC provided customized training programs to students from ten local schools in Kunming, as well as coach education clinics for local coaches. UEFA-certified coaches were sent to these schools to train both students and coaches with hundreds of students and around eighty local coaches participating in the programs.
The renewal of the collaboration makes it a long-term cooperation between the two sides. Liverpool FC will continue to help with the development of youth football talents and coaches in Kunming, the southwestern city of China, via the Liverpool International Academy Kunming. It is reported that the academy is planned around strong training programs and annual youth football competitions.
